What Is a Bail Bond?
A bail bond is a financial agreement that allows an arrested person to be launched from protection while waiting for test. This arrangement entails a third party, typically a bondsman, who assures the court that the person will return for their set up court appearances. For this service, the Bail bondsman typically bills a non-refundable charge, often a percent of the complete Bail amount.
Bail bonds offer an important function in the lawful system, providing a system for offenders to preserve their liberty during the pre-trial phase. This can aid them get ready for their protection much more properly. The Bail amount is determined by the court based on different variables, consisting of the seriousness of the offense, the defendant's criminal background, and the danger of trip. Inevitably, a bail bond stands for a commitment to promote legal responsibilities while permitting individuals the opportunity to proceed their day-to-days live until their court day.
How Bail Bonds Work
Bail bonds operate through a straightforward procedure that involves a number of crucial actions. Originally, an offender or their representative get in touches with a bail bond representative after an apprehension. The agent evaluates the situation, consisting of the Bail amount set by the court and the accused's history. Once a decision is made, the agent normally calls for a non-refundable charge, generally a percent of the overall Bail amount, commonly ranging from 10% to 15%.
After the fee is paid, the representative safeguards the Bail by authorizing an agreement with the court, making certain that the defendant appears for all scheduled court dates. If the defendant fails to appear, the bail bond agent is responsible for the complete Bail quantity, leading the agent to seek the defendant. Throughout this process, the bail bond representative plays an important role in promoting the launch of the offender while handling the connected financial risks.
Types of Bail Bonds
Recognizing the numerous kinds of Bail bonds is vital for accuseds and their family members as they navigate the legal system. There are numerous typical kinds of Bail bonds readily available, each serving a particular purpose.
The most common is the surety bond, which entails a Bail bondsman guaranteeing the complete Bail quantity in exchange for a charge. One more kind is the cash bond, where the defendant or their family members pays the full Bail quantity in money directly to the court.
Property bonds permit individuals to use property as collateral for the Bail amount. Furthermore, government bonds are certain to federal situations, typically needing a greater premium and more rigid conditions.
Migration bonds are used in instances concerning migration violations. Each type of bond has unique treatments and ramifications, making it essential for those involved to understand their options extensively.
The Costs Associated With Securing a Bail Bond
Securing a bail bond involves different prices that can considerably influence a defendant's financial resources. The major expense is the premium, normally varying from 10% to 15% of the total Bail amount set by the court. This premium is non-refundable, no matter the instance outcome, standing for the bail bond agent's charge for their services. Extra expenses might include management costs, which some representatives enforce for handling documentation, and collateral demands, where the offender might require to provide assets to protect the bond. Obligations of the Indemnitor
Steering via the complexities of Bail bonds requires a clear understanding of the duties of the indemnitor. The indemnitor, typically a loved one or good friend of the accused, plays a significant duty in the Bail procedure. This private consents to think monetary responsibility, making sure that the Bail amount is paid if the offender stops working to show up in court. It is essential for the indemnitor to maintain interaction with the bail bond representative throughout the process, providing any type of necessary info and updates regarding the offender's situation.
Furthermore, the indemnitor should protect collateral, which may consist of property or belongings, to back the bail bond. Common Myths Concerning Bail Bonds
Numerous people nurture misunderstandings concerning Bail bonds, which can complicate their understanding of the Bail process. One widespread myth is that Bail bonds are a type of payment that ensures an accused's release. Actually, they are a warranty to the court that the defendant will appear for their arranged hearings. Another typical idea is that only affluent people can manage Bail. Bail bondsmen usually bill a percent of the overall Bail quantity, making it accessible to a broader range of individuals.
